Our Installation Process
Size the Space: Measure the entire measurement of the straight walls in your space. For instance, it may require one 12-foot section of crown molding to trim every lesser wall, and a pair of 8-foot sections for every large wall, especially in a 165 sq. ft. room with two 15-foot walls and two 11-foot walls.
Crown molding should be cut: To begin the process, the crown molding piece must be measured and indicated before cutting. Even though a manual miter saw can be used for miter-cutting crown molding, preferring a power miter saw can be preferred since cuts will be more exact.
Clean up the Wood: In many cases, the majority of molding already comes with a primer coat of paint, but if you opt for bare wood molding, you should apply a coat of primer to the wood and allow it to dry for at least an hour before installing it to the wall.
Locate and mark the wall studs: Use a stud finder and a pencil to locate and label each wall stud on the wall surface, positioning the marks several inches beneath the junction of the wall and ceiling. These marks act as a point of reference while nailing the crown molding pieces together.
Fit the crown molding in place: Preceding installing the crown molding on the wall, invert it so that it is upright. Enlist an assistant to aid you in positioning the molding on a second ladder and managing it while you proceed. Begin at the center of the wall.
Caulk Holes: Gaps and spaces may periodically arise between the molding and both the walls and ceiling, because rarely are the walls and ceilings absolutely even. To resolve these spaces, it's possible to fill them up by using a bead of flexible, paintable caulk along them. Any remaining gaps at those mitered corners are also rectified with caulk.
Painting the Molding: If you haven't already applied paint to them, put painter's tape along the top and bottom edges of the moldings at the points where they meet both the wall and ceiling.
